Job Summary The Transportation Digital Delivery Manager will be the primary technical contact for the delivery of major transport projects across Enterprise Capabilities (EC) Digital. This will include all Enterprise Critical Pursuits and Tier 2 projects. As AECOM moves to standardize how our largest projects are delivered, this role will determine project delivery strategy for all transport projects, develop and implement technical processes and standards, and collaborate with other digital implementation leads.

Key Responsibilities

Determine the technology stack to be used to deliver projects, from the standardized Cornerstone tool sets

Determine project data standard requirements to be implemented on projects

Outline the digital production processes to be used by project delivery teams

Work with Planning to identify suitable resources and outline project programs

Work with Assurance to proactively monitor projects during delivery to ensure they continuously meet all quality metrics

Enable EC Digital’s Delivery Service and the wider organization to successfully adopt project execution standard

Collaborate with all other digital implementation leads and the wider DPA team to continuously improve our standardized delivery approach for major projects

What We Are Looking For To be successful in this critical role, you will need significant experience delivering large, complex transport projects, a sound technical understanding of various technologies, and the capability to lead and influence project teams and senior digital leadership.

Qualifications Minimum Requirements

Bachelor's Degree and 10+ years’ experience working on delivery of large, complex transportation projects or demonstrated equivalency of experience and/or education, including 2 years of leadership

5 years working in a digital leadership role in a large engineering organization

Thorough understanding of Industry-standard platforms (Autodesk, Bentley, GIS platforms)

Thorough understanding of industry standard project delivery authoring technologies and their application to engineering design and/or construction

Extensive experience with the Bentley delivery suite, and experience with Autodesk Civil 3D

Thorough understanding of international standards such as ISO 19650 and how they are applied within various Common Data Environment (CDE) technologies

Proven ability to lead and influence within a large organization

Excellent communications skills, enabling you to bridge the gap between technical and business issues related to project delivery

Project management skills, with a focus on integrating digital into planning, delivery, or operations

Proven ability to engage in the proposal and bid processes to articulate digital capabilities

Leadership experience managing cross‑functional teams and driving organizational change

Computation Design methods and technologies

Through understanding programming skills related to data management or model authoring, using traditional coding or low‑code methods

Knowledge of regional market dynamics, client expectations, and regulatory frameworks
